In the financial services industry, Tata Investment Corporation is a large-cap firm. As of Friday's BSE closing session, its market value was Rs 35,170.81 Cr. A non-banking financial firm, Tata Investment Corporation Limited (TICL) specialises in long-term investments such as equity shares and equity-related securities. The Tata group NBFC stock is going to be in focus in the coming sessions as the Board of Directors will meet soon to consider dividends for FY24.

Tata Investment Corporation News

"A meeting of the Board of Directors of the Company will be held on Wednesday, April 24, 2024, inter alia, to consider and approve: i. The Audited Standalone and Consolidated financial results of the Company for the financial year ended March 31, 2024; ii. Recommendation of dividend, if any, on the equity shares of the Company for the financial year ended March 31, 2024. In accordance with the 'Tata Code of Conduct for Prevention of Insider Trading' pursuant to the amended SEBI (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015, the Company has intimated its Designated Persons regarding the closure of the trading window from Monday, March 25, 2024 to Friday, April 26, 2024 (both days inclusive)," said Tata Investment Corporation in a regulatory filing on April 10, 2024.

Tata Investment Corporation Dividend Yield

A 480.00% equity dividend, or Rs 48 per share, at face value of Rs 10 has been declared by Tata Investment Corporation for the fiscal year ended in March 2023. This translates as a dividend yield of 0.69% at the current share price of Rs 6951.40 on BSE. With five years of straight dividend declarations under its belt, the firm has a solid dividend track record. Trendlyne data indicates that since September 4, 2000, Tata Investment Corporation Ltd. issued 28 dividends.

Tata Investment Corporation Financials

On a consolidated basis, the company posted revenue from operations of Rs 50.55 crore in the December 2023 quarter up 34.23% from Rs. 37.66 crore in the December 2022 quarter. Its net profit reached Rs. 53.24 crore in Q3FY24 up 54.18% from Rs. 34.53 crore in Q3FY23. Tata Investment Corporation said in a regulatory filing that its quarterly consolidated EBITDA stood at Rs. 45.23 crore in the reported quarter, up 43% from Rs. 31.63 crore in the corresponding quarter of FY23.
